AAU optical module bandwidth

AAU optical modules in 5G networks typically support 25 Gbps per channel, with some dual-rate modules supporting both 10G and 25G for flexible deployment.Bandwidth and InterfaceModern 5G AAUs use optical modules to connect to Distributed Units (DUs) via the fronthaul network. The standard bandwidth for these modules is 25 Gbps, primarily using the eCPRI interface, which replaces the older 100 Gbps CPRI links used in 4G networks . Some optical modules are dual-rate, supporting both 10 Gbps and 25 Gbps, allowing backward compatibility with 4G services while enabling high-speed 5G transmission .Wavelength and Module TypesAAU optical modules often operate in the 1270–1370 nm wavelength range, and can be deployed as single-rate 25G modules or 10G/25G dual-rate modules.
